HANSKA WINS 2-1, STAYS ALIVE IN LOSER'S BRACKET

ARLINGTON - Landon Rathmann's solo home run gave Hanska a 2-1 win over St. Martin and advanced the Lakers in the loser's bracket fo the state amateur baseball tournament here Saturday. Hanska now will meet Winsted at 1 p.m. Sunday.
Draftee Kyle Fischer (New Ulm Brewers) went the distance for the win, granting only four singles, stirking out seven and walking one. He also batted in the first Hanska run in the fourth, driving in Chris Peters whose singles was one of two hits for him in the game.
In Saturday's Class C games St. Cloud Orthopedic edged Cannon Falls 2-0 and Winsted topped Blue Earth 2-1.

Today in Class B at Gaylord, Sauk Rapids plays Hastings at 1 p.m. with the winner going against Prior Lake. In Class C, the Hanska/Winsted winner goes against Cannon Falls at 3:30 at Arlington. Championship gameswill be played Monday.
